Transaction 79c85a367f15ff54e8fa90fc1fef29bcb9e9179a25f2721c0025c028c77dc2fa

43 Input
2 Outputs
  • 79c85a367f15ff54e8fa90fc1fef29bcb9e9179a25f2721c0025c028c77dc2fa:0
  • value  87872
    address  1BuTGRFzNFX3xMkHLg3i4tvD5BWmrzXqzv
  • 79c85a367f15ff54e8fa90fc1fef29bcb9e9179a25f2721c0025c028c77dc2fa:1
  • value  17112728
    address  3MRbvsDtSBQtPys34TjRErHMPyhHWJzN39